YOUR ROLE:

As a PC&L Manager you will lead our Plant Production Control & Logistics team in Tatabanya. In this prestigious role, you will oversee supply chain operations, implement effective problem-solving strategies, ensure production continuity, and manage logistics costs to drive operational excellence.

  • Team Leadership: Supervise a team of 3-10 professionals within the PC&L department, implementing appropriate headcount and structure
  • Performance Management: Achieve defined targets including budget, DIO, inventory management, premium freight, E&O, customer complaints, and IPM
  • Lean Implementation: Drive and monitor Lean Operating Systems including Scheduling, Ordering, Manufacturing Connections, and Logistics
  • Continuous Improvement: Monitor SQDIPK PC&L related metrics and ensure corrective actions are defined and executed
  • Project Management: Oversee project transitions, business transfers, and MYC with focus on PC&L process impacts
  • Team Development: Implement training & certification processes while continuously developing team capabilities
  • Health & Safety: Ensure proper execution of H&S procedures in all PC&L areas

Your Background :

  • Bachelor's/Master's degree with operational expertise justified with minimum 5 years' experience in a PC&L supervisory position within automotive.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of logistics & supply chain processes including inventory management
  • Fluent communication skills in English - additional language skills are advantageous. Hungarian language is mandatory.
  • Strong managerial skills: organized, able to delegate, motivate and coach a team
  • Results-oriented with ability to transfer knowledge and make decisive decisions
  • Skilled at building networks and relationships
